Output 53d24be3a15b18b90ddfd437f2e4fffb72eb17b0ae0a08362b80f13031d81046:1

value
705426
script pubkey
OP_0 OP_PUSHBYTES_20 020f51ef2fe3c07998eab78bd852979f5ac2b57c
address
bc1qqg84rme0u0q8nx82k79as55hnadv9dtukl7s5s
transaction
53d24be3a15b18b90ddfd437f2e4fffb72eb17b0ae0a08362b80f13031d81046